The real estate markets in Dubai, Abu Dhabi, and Damascus have seen significant developments following the fall of dictatorships in the respective regions. These cities have experienced contrasting trajectories in terms of real estate growth and investment opportunities.

Dubai and Abu Dhabi, both cities in the United Arab Emirates, have emerged as major real estate hubs in the Middle East. Following the downfall of authoritarian regimes in the region, these cities have attracted significant foreign investment and witnessed rapid urban development. The real estate sector in Dubai, known for its luxurious high-rise buildings and iconic structures, has continued to thrive, with a steady stream of new projects and developments. Abu Dhabi, on the other hand, has focused on creating sustainable communities and infrastructure projects, such as the Masdar City eco-community. In contrast, Damascus, the capital of Syria, has faced immense challenges in its real estate market following years of civil war and political instability. The city has struggled to attract investment and rebuild its infrastructure in the aftermath of the dictatorship. The real estate sector in Damascus has been deeply impacted by the conflict, with many properties damaged or destroyed and a lack of investment flowing into the market. Despite the differing circumstances in these cities, there are opportunities for real estate investment in each location. Dubai and Abu Dhabi continue to offer attractive investment prospects for those seeking high-end properties or rental yields, while Damascus presents a unique opportunity for investors looking to contribute to the reconstruction efforts in the war-torn city. Overall, the real estate markets in Dubai, Abu Dhabi, and Damascus have seen significant shifts following the fall of dictatorships in their respective regions. While Dubai and Abu Dhabi have experienced growth and development, Damascus faces challenges in rebuilding its real estate sector amid ongoing political instability and conflict.
